'Cakes Defeat El Paso

June 14, 2019 - Pacific Coast League (PCL1)
New Orleans Baby Cakes News Release


El Paso - Gabriel Guerrero pounded a two run home run and added four hits and four runs batted in as New Orleans defeated El Paso 7-6. The win snapped a nine game losing streak for New Orleans in Southwest University Park dating back to 2014.

The Chihuahuas scored a pair in the first inning touching up New Orleans starter Hector Noesi. The 'Cakes bounced back with the Guerrero home run in the second and added four runs in the third inning. Noesi allowed four runs on five hits and earned his sixth win of the season.

The 'Cakes added a run in the fifth inning with a Guerrero one out single and New Orleans led 7-3. The Chihuahua's the league leading offense would answer with three home runs and scored two in the ninth inning but the rally would fall short and Kyle Keller earns the save.

The Baby Cakes improve to 36-31 on the season.

GAME NOTES- Isan Diaz extended his hitting streak to 14 games. New Orleans improved to 9-14 in one run games. The 'Cakes are in a stretch of 30 of 39 games on the road.
